Juvenile Justice Resource Hub Launched

March 3, 2014

The National Juvenile Justice Network has launched the Juvenile Justice Resource Hub, a new resource developed in partnership with Juvenile Justice Information Exchange and the MacArthur Foundation’s Models for Change. The hub provides a high-quality overview of key issues in juvenile justice as well as strategies for change and resources, including research, toolkits, and links to national experts. The Center for Sustainable Journalism at Kennesaw State University maintains the hub.
